Overexpression of Cdc25A128His or Cdc25A128Gln decreases the ability of bone marrow cells to form BFU-E. / Bone marrow cells were infected with retroviruses expressing Cdc25A128His, Cdc25A128Gln, or vector control and were plated in methylcellulose media containing EPO, SCF, and G418 to select for infected cells. Colonies were scored 7 days after plating. (A) Overexpression of Cdc25A128His or Cdc25A128Gln significantly decreases the number of BFU-E compared with vector control. *P < .01; **P < .001. (B) Overexpression of Cdc25A128Gln significantly decreases the number of CFU-C. All non–BFU-E colonies were scored as CFU-C. **P < .001. Each bar represents the average of 3 independent experiments.
